Designing Dynamic Game Environments
Once you've mastered the basics, the course moves on to harnessing the power of algorithms to design dynamic game environments. Dynamic environments are those that change based on player actions or other in-game events. This could mean altering the weather, adjusting the difficulty level, or even changing the layout of a level. By understanding how to implement these changes, you can create more engaging and responsive game worlds that adapt to the player's actions.
